My Buying Guides on Best Attic Door Hinge Kit
When I started looking for the best attic door hinge kit, I realized that not all kits are built the same. Some are designed for lightweight attic doors, while others are made to handle heavier panels with smoother folding and better durability. Based on my experience, the right hinge kit can make attic access safer, easier, and much more reliable.
1. Build Quality and Material
The first thing I check is the material. I prefer hinge kits made from heavy-duty steel or rust-resistant metal because they hold up better over time. If I want something long-lasting, I avoid flimsy parts that bend easily or show wear too soon. A strong hinge kit gives me confidence that the attic door will stay secure.
2. Weight Capacity
I always pay close attention to how much weight the hinge kit can support. Attic doors can be heavier than they look, especially if they are insulated or made from solid wood. I make sure the kit matches the door’s weight so the hinges don’t strain or fail later.
3. Smooth Operation
For me, a good attic door hinge kit should open and close smoothly without sticking or squeaking. I look for designs that allow easy folding and controlled movement. If the kit feels stiff or awkward, I know it may become frustrating to use over time.
4. Easy Installation
I prefer a kit that comes with clear instructions and all the necessary hardware. Since I don’t want to spend hours figuring things out, I look for products that are beginner-friendly and designed for straightforward installation. A simple setup saves me time and reduces mistakes.
5. Compatibility with My Attic Door
Before buying, I always check whether the hinge kit fits my attic door dimensions and style. Some kits work better with specific door thicknesses or frame types. I’ve learned that compatibility matters just as much as quality because even a great hinge kit won’t help if it doesn’t fit properly.
6. Safety Features
Safety is a big concern for me, especially when I’m dealing with attic access. I look for hinge kits that keep the door stable and reduce the risk of sudden drops or misalignment. A secure hinge system helps me feel safer every time I use the attic.
7. Durability and Maintenance
I like products that don’t need constant adjustment or upkeep. A durable attic door hinge kit should resist wear, stay aligned, and work well for years. I usually choose kits that are known for low maintenance because I want a solution that lasts.
8. Value for Money
I don’t always go for the cheapest option. Instead, I look for the best balance between price and quality. In my experience, spending a little more on a dependable hinge kit is better than replacing a weak one later.
